NOTE
A CL transducer is considered still active, even if it has an INOP condition (e.g. cl US Disconnect), until
it is either deactivated by docking it at the base station, or until it is manually removed from the
Tele
Info
window.

Messages
The fetal monitor issues messages to certain user interactions. For example, if the CL SpO
2
Pod is
picked up from the base station to activate it, the monitor displays the message
cl SpO Added and the
equipment label of the CL Pod.

A CL transducer has moved away from the base station and is approaching the limit of the area of
reach (min. 100 m/300 ft in line of sight). The US sound is replaced by an artificial QRS sound
(like DECG). The DECG and MECG waves are no longer displayed.

Indicator Avalon CL
Pop-Up key Function
Remove Selecting the Remove key deactivates and unassigns the selected active
transducer or CL Pod and removes it from the list. This key is disabled if no
active device is selected.
Find Selecting the Find key pages the selected active CL transducer. This key is
disabled if no active device is selected.
